Cuppa:
Old Stuff in a New Gown

Cuppa has its roots in Goudy’s Copperplate Gothic. It is a reinterpretation; less dry and dusty. Freshly brewed. Equipped with lowercase.



Though in its early stages, Cuppa is already quite expressive. It maintains the prominent features and proportions from the source of inspiration. But also exaggerates and pushes them to a limit.

 

All just to stress the weirdness and quirkiness from the original design even more.
